(11) Exhaust Temperature Sensor

NOTE

• Since it is not possible to do unit checking for this sensor, judge the sensor is faulty if the relating electric

circuit is normal.

9Y1210824ELS0122US0

Connector Voltage

1. Disconnect the connector, and turn the main key switch 

"ON"

position.

2. Measure  the  voltage  with  a  voltmeter  across  the  terminals

shown in the table below.

3. If  the  reference  value  is  not  indicated  as  shown  in  the  table

below, check the relating electric circuit.

9Y1210824ELS0123US0

Sensor Resistance (for Reference)

1. Measure the resistance with an ohmmeter across the terminals

shown in the table below.

2. If the reference value is not indicated, the exhaust temperature

sensor is faulty.
